You know don't take it too seriously but how many of you are familiar with a book written decades ago called The Celestine Prophecy? Have you ever heard of that? It was a very influential, it's a fiction it's just a fictional story but a key concept in those books was that when people started noticing coincidences more often the coincidences were a signal for a consciousness shift that human awareness was about to take a leap.
Now I've always been fascinated by that and there's no reason in the world to think that a consciousness shift would be preceded by some kind of bunch of coincidences unless there's an obvious reason for it. You want to hear an obvious reason why you might notice more coincidences right before a perceptual shift? Like a really obvious reason. The coincidences were always there but your awareness improved and you're just noticing something that was right in front of you the whole time but you just didn't see it.
